Quantcast
Channel: SQL Server Analysis Services Forum
Viewing all articles
Browse latest Browse all 2472

How to find sum of effort value after grouping by date

$
0
0

I have following MDX query, I need to find sum(Microsoft_VSTS_Scheduling_Effort) after group by date. 

WITH
SET [Date Range] AS
		Filter(
			[Date].[Date].[Date],
			[Date].[Date].CurrentMember.Member_Value >= CDate(@StartDateParam) AND
			[Date].[Date].CurrentMember.Member_Value <= CDate(@EndDateParam)
		)
	 MEMBER [Measures].[DateValue] AS [Date].[Date].CurrentMember.Member_Value

SELECT
{
	[Measures].[Microsoft_VSTS_Scheduling_Effort]
} ON COLUMNS,
{
	CrossJoin(
                                [Date Range],
		[Work Item].[System_State].[System_State],
		[Work Item].[Iteration Path].[Iteration Path]
	)
} ON ROWS
FROM
(
	SELECT
		CrossJoin(
			StrToMember("[Team Project].[Project Node GUID].&[{" + @ProjectGuid + "}]"),
                StrToSet('{[Work Item].[System_WorkItemType].&[Product Backlog Item],[Work Item].[System_WorkItemType].&[Bug]}'),
                StrToSet('{[Work Item].[System_State].&[New],[Work Item].[System_State].&[Approved],[Work Item].[System_State].&[Committed],[Work Item].[System_State].&[Done]}'),
(	Filter( 
							[Work Item].[Iteration Path].[Iteration Path].Members, 
iif([Work Item].[Iteration Path].currentmember.Properties( 'Member_Caption') = @WorkItemIterationPath OR Instr( [Work Item].[Iteration Path].currentmember.Properties( 'Member_Caption'),  @WorkItemIterationPath1 )  = 1,1,0)				 )
                )
		) ON COLUMNS
	FROM [Team System]
)


Viewing all articles
Browse latest Browse all 2472

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>